dc.description.abstract | Ternary metal halides (A(3)X(2)I(9)) have attracted considerable interest because they have good:stability and reduced toxicity compared with Pb-based halide perovskites. The main issue with A(3)X(2)I(9) is their band gap, which is relatively large for use in a single junction solar cell (1.9-2.2 eV for the Cs3Bi2I9). This theoretical study found that the band gap of Cs3Bi2I9 can be successfully modulated by using dual metal cations, i.e., by forming. Cs3Bi2I9 (X: trivalent cation). Among the various trivalent atoms, investigated, In and Ga showed very promising band gap modulation behaviors. Additionally, the indirect band gap of Cs3Bi2I9 can be changed into a direct nand gap. | - |
